From 320cd1ea2d17c86179fa69a8da5584397ab2a2e1 Mon Sep 17 00:00:00 2001 From: dougb Date: Wed, 15 Aug 2012 01:04:30 +0000 Subject: Fix problem introduced in r302141. The directory for the unpacked source files is unversioned, so it conflicts with the name of the rc.d script in WRKDIR after SUB_FILES is applied. --- mail/couriergraph/Makefile | 4 +++- mail/exilog/Makefile | 4 +++- mail/missey/Makefile | 5 +++-- mail/spamilter/Makefile | 4 +++- 4 files changed, 12 insertions(+), 5 deletions(-) (limited to 'mail') diff --git a/mail/couriergraph/Makefile b/mail/couriergraph/Makefile index 2c3bcb98913e..1bb49bb9a11b 100644 --- a/mail/couriergraph/Makefile +++ b/mail/couriergraph/Makefile @@ -20,7 +20,6 @@ RUN_DEPENDS= rrdtool>=0:${PORTSDIR}/databases/rrdtool \ NO_BUILD= yes USE_PERL5= yes -WRKSRC= ${WRKDIR}/${PORTNAME} DATADIR?= /var/db/couriergraph COURIERGRAPH_USER?= ${WWWOWN} @@ -42,6 +41,9 @@ pre-everything:: @${ECHO_MSG} "COURIERGRAPH_GROUP=www Group to run couriergraph (Default: ${WWWGRP})" @${ECHO_MSG} +post-extract: + @${MV} ${WRKDIR}/${PORTNAME} ${WRKSRC} + post-patch: @${REINPLACE_CMD} -e "s,%%DATADIR%%,${DATADIR}," ${WRKSRC}/couriergraph.cgi @${REINPLACE_CMD} -e "s,%%DATADIR%%,${DATADIR}," ${WRKSRC}/couriergraph.pl diff --git a/mail/exilog/Makefile b/mail/exilog/Makefile index 34422b05c8b8..84da6a44d2ac 100644 --- a/mail/exilog/Makefile +++ b/mail/exilog/Makefile @@ -20,7 +20,6 @@ RUN_DEPENDS= p5-Net-Netmask>=0:${PORTSDIR}/net-mgmt/p5-Net-Netmask USE_PERL5= yes NO_BUILD= yes -WRKSRC= ${WRKDIR}/${PORTNAME} # Default sql backend WITH_SQL_BACKEND?= mysql @@ -59,6 +58,9 @@ PORTDOC_FILES= doc/Changelog \ doc/pgsql-db-script.sql .endif +post-extract: + @${MV} ${WRKDIR}/${PORTNAME} ${WRKSRC} + pre-patch: @${REINPLACE_CMD} -e 's,$$RealBin/exilog.conf,${PREFIX}/etc/exilog.conf,' ${WRKSRC}/exilog_config.pm @${REINPLACE_CMD} -e "s,\(use exilog_config\),use lib \'${EXILOGDIR}\'; \1," ${WRKSRC}/exilog_agent.pl diff --git a/mail/missey/Makefile b/mail/missey/Makefile index dedae3501928..34d5b0818317 100644 --- a/mail/missey/Makefile +++ b/mail/missey/Makefile @@ -18,8 +18,6 @@ COMMENT= Secure small and high performance POP3 server USE_BZIP2= yes -WRKSRC= ${WRKDIR}/mps/src - MAKE_ENV+= PTHREAD_CFLAGS="${PTHREAD_CFLAGS}" PTHREAD_LIBS="${PTHREAD_LIBS}" \ INSTALL_PROGRAM="${INSTALL_PROGRAM}" \ INSTALL_DATA="${INSTALL_DATA}" MKDIR="${MKDIR}" WRKSRC="${WRKSRC}" @@ -29,6 +27,9 @@ PLIST_DIRS= etc/mps USE_RC_SUBR= mps +post-extract: + @${MV} ${WRKDIR}/mps/src ${WRKSRC} + post-patch: @${CP} ${FILESDIR}/Makefile ${WRKSRC}/Makefile diff --git a/mail/spamilter/Makefile b/mail/spamilter/Makefile index 25153ba6d592..d473a697ceb0 100644 --- a/mail/spamilter/Makefile +++ b/mail/spamilter/Makefile @@ -23,7 +23,6 @@ HAS_CONFIGURE= yes CONFIGURE_ARGS= --have-resn USE_RC_SUBR= spamilter -WRKSRC= ${WRKDIR}/${PORTNAME} CFLAGS+= ${PTHREAD_CFLAGS:S=""==} LDFLAGS+= ${PTHREAD_LIBS} MAKE_ENV+= __MAKE_CONF=/dev/null @@ -64,6 +63,9 @@ PLIST_FILES+= bin/dnsblchk bin/dnsblupd bin/ipfwmtad bin/mxlookup \ PORTDOCS= Changelog INSTALL LICENSE docs.html docs.txt db.rcpt \ db.rdnsbl db.sndr policy.html spamilter.rc +post-extract: + @${MV} ${WRKDIR}/${PORTNAME} ${WRKSRC} + pre-configure: ${REINPLACE_CMD} \ -e "s=/etc/spamilter.rc=${PREFIX}/etc/spamilter.rc=" \ -- cgit